森林法第15條第4項傳統領域概念之適用與檢討-評最高法院109年度台上字第3148號刑事判決及其歷審判決

Analysis and Critique of the Application of the Concept of the Traditional Territory of Aboriginal People in Article 15 of The Forestry Act

摘要


本文以我國法院對原住民族傳統領域概念之適用現況,作為觀察與討論的對象。首先,從原住民基本法第19條與森林法第15條第4項之制定,以及2019年原住民族依生活慣俗採取森林產物規則的制定中,可以觀察到我國法規範兼顧自然生態保育與原住民族文化維護的發展方向。同時,從我國法院判決的發展中,也可以觀察到法院對原住民族森林產物採集行為,採取肯定其行為合法性的發展趨勢。不過,在最高法院109年度台上字第3148號刑事判決中,可以觀察到另一條相反的發展路徑,也就是對原住民合法採集行為採取限縮解釋的發展方向。根據該判決,原住民族只能在自身所隸屬族群的傳統領域內,才享有合法採集森林產物的權利,反之在其他原住民族的傳統領域內採集時,將會構成犯罪行為。結論上,本文認為最高法院此一判決具有以下四點錯誤:一、錯誤地由財產權概念來理解傳統領域;二、錯誤地以傳統領域作為合法採集行為的判斷基準;三、違反罪刑法定原則之嫌;四、忽略傳統領域概念與歷史記憶間的關係。

並列摘要


This article focuses on the circumstance of the application of the concept of the traditional territory of aboriginal people in Taiwanese criminal trials. First, the amendments to Article 19 of the Indigenous Peoples Basic Law and Article 15 of the Forestry Law, and the legislation of Forest Products Collection Rule in 2019 show the development that Taiwan law emphasizes environmental protection and protection of indigenous peoples' culture. At the same time, in view of the development of criminal trials in Taiwan, there is a tendency for judges to confirm the legality of the act of taking forest products. However, in the Supreme Court's 2019 case, there are developments that oppose the aforementioned developments. In other words, the development trend is to interpret the act of legal collection of forest products by Taiwan indigenous peoples in a limited way. According to this case, Taiwan indigenous peoples will have the right to legally collect forest products within the traditional territories of their own tribes or villages. On the contrary, Taiwan indigenous peoples are criminal when they collect in the traditional territories of other tribes. In the conclusion, there are four mistakes in this case. First, understand the concept of traditional territory from the perspective of property rights. Second, the legality of the act of taking forest products is judged based on the range of traditional territory. Third, there is a risk of violating "Nulla poena sine lege". Finally, ignore the connection between the concept of traditional territory and historical memory.
